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Blackfoot Polypore | Bobak Marmot |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Fungi (Fungi)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Basidiomycota (Club Fungi)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Agaricomycetes (Mushrooms)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Polyporales (Polyporales) | Rodentia (Rodents) |
| Family | Polyporaceae | Sciuridae (Squirrels) |
| Genus | Cerioporus | Marmota |
| Species | Cerioporus leptocephalus | Marmota bobak |
